Rapid Expansion Into Hormone Therapy Services

The investigation comes amid Planned Parenthood’s significant expansion into providing what they call “gender-affirming care.” According to reports, nearly 600 Planned Parenthood centers across America now offer cross-sex hormones, a massive increase from just 32 locations in 2016. The organization’s own data shows these services increased by 49% from 2021 to 2022 alone. This expansion has been characterized by critics as a strategy to compensate for potential revenue losses in states restricting abortion services following the Supreme Court’s decision to overturn Roe v. Wade.

Congressional Scrutiny and Funding Questions

Planned Parenthood’s expansion into hormone therapy has drawn intense scrutiny from Congressional Republicans who question whether taxpayer dollars should fund these services. Senator Bill Cassidy has specifically called out the organization for its “opaque reporting” practices regarding gender transition services. Cassidy noted a suspicious increase in Planned Parenthood’s “Other Procedures” category, which jumped from 17,791 in 2020 to 256,550 in 2021, potentially masking the true extent of hormone therapies being administered.

“I am troubled that your organization buried data on the breadth of the services it provides. Gender transition services are experimental at best and permanently damaging at worst,” stated Dr. Cassidy in communications with Planned Parenthood. “Therefore, the American people deserve to have the full picture of the gender transition services your organization provides to ensure no taxpayer dollars fund these procedures.”
